Summary
Jan Hrnčíř is a Senior Java Backend & DevOps Engineer with 11 years of experience building and operating resilient backend systems and PostgreSQL databases from Prague. He blends hands-on Java (Spring Boot, Java 17–21) development with deep DevOps expertise—CI/CD, Docker Swarm and Kubernetes, ELK/Grafana monitoring, and Unix automation using Bash and Python. His background includes zero-downtime database migrations, cross-platform build pipelines, and maintaining Jenkins/GitLab CI ecosystems for production-grade services. With a PhD-level grounding in AI from Czech Technical University and an MSc from the University of Edinburgh, he brings research-driven rigor to practical infrastructure problems. Colleagues rely on him for pragmatic, low-downtime operational strategies and readable support tooling that keep services running smoothly. He’s motivated by complex migration challenges and continually adopts new technologies to close the gap between research ideas and robust production systems.
